Yes, someone can pick up your PSA birth certificate for you, provided they have a signed authorization letter for PSA. This letter serves as proof of your consent and should detail the authorized person's name and their relationship to you. Always double-check the requirements to avoid any delays in processing your request.

Yes, a handwritten authorization letter is valid as long as it includes specific details and your signature. The key is that the letter must clearly communicate your intent and identification to avoid misunderstandings. Always keep a copy for your records, especially when authorizing someone to handle important documents like a PSA birth certificate.
To write a letter of authorization, start with your contact details followed by the date and the recipient's information. Clearly state your intent to authorize someone and include their name and the specific action they are permitted to take, like receiving your PSA birth certificate. It's smart to conclude with your signature and the date to validate the authorization.
